Firstly, I do know that Ken Films "Empire Strikes Back" just made it into the LPP era in it's last prints, as have been evidenced on this forum, (I have gotten nowhere in talking a part 1 out of a fellow member, but I'm not giving up hope!)
However, I'm pretty sure that no agfa prints of "Empire" exist. From my source in Germany, the "Empire" prints over there were pretty much shipped in US prints, (do not be misled by the title, "Opti-color" on German prins, they are Kodak SP as well, as are most of the better US prints.
In the 70's, before the advent of LPP, the overseas market was the market that mainly used AGFA or Fuji (another largely good stock), while sadly, the US market mostly used, sadly , eastman pinky or Kodak, which could be hit oir miss.
